Output f8ce5826c36fbee098a5bb3841d6a64e3a30c74433a22911bac978120099b71a:68

value
1236766
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4f1e77aee8a20d02bb32eda21ed2d179f7226ee OP_EQUAL
address
3KeN9wcKVsQC8tCmC4yAbsocVKfaLCKfKF
transaction
f8ce5826c36fbee098a5bb3841d6a64e3a30c74433a22911bac978120099b71a
confirmations
221826
spent
true